shape是查看數據有多少行多少列reshape()是數組array中的方法,作用是將數據重新組織 1.shape 2.reshape() 是數組對象中的方法,用於改變數組的形狀。 形狀變化是基於數組元素不能改變的,變成的新形狀中所包含的元素個數必須符合原來元素個數。如果數組 ...
from:http: blog.csdn.net by study article details 環境:Windows, Python . 一維情況: gt gt gt gt import numpy as np gt gt gt a np.array , , gt gt gt a array gt gt gt print a gt gt gt a.shape , gt gt gt a.shap ...
2017-12-20 17:24 0 9894 推薦指數:
shape是查看數據有多少行多少列reshape()是數組array中的方法,作用是將數據重新組織 1.shape 2.reshape() 是數組對象中的方法,用於改變數組的形狀。 形狀變化是基於數組元素不能改變的,變成的新形狀中所包含的元素個數必須符合原來元素個數。如果數組 ...
numpy 創建的數組都有一個shape屬性,它是一個元組,返回各個維度的維數。有時候我們可能需要知道某一維的特定維數。 二維 y是一個兩行三列的二維數組,y.shape[0]代表行數,y.shape[1]代表列數。 三維 x是一個包含 ...
shape函數是numpy.core.fromnumeric中的函數,它的功能是讀取矩陣的長度,比如shape[0]就是讀取矩陣第一維度的長度。它的輸入參數可以使一個整數表示維度,也可以是一個矩陣。這么說你可能不太理解,我們還是用各種例子來說明他的用法: 一維矩陣[1]返回值為(1L ...
shape函數是numpy.core.fromnumeric中的函數,它的功能是讀取矩陣的長度,比如shape[0]就是讀取矩陣第一維度的長度。它的輸入參數可以使一個整數表示維度,也可以是一個矩陣。這么說你可能不太理解,我們還是用各種例子來說明他的用法: 一維矩陣[1]返回值為(1L ...
1. shape()函數返回矩陣的規模 2.size()函數主要是用來統計矩陣元素個數,或矩陣某一維上的元素個數的函數。 參數numpy.size(a, axis=None)a:輸入的矩陣axis:int型的可選參數,指定返回哪一維的元素個數。當沒有指定時,返回整個矩陣的元素個數 ...
numpy.array 的shape屬性理解 在碼最鄰近算法(K-Nearest Neighbor)的過程中,發現示例使用了numpy的array數組管理,其中關於array數組的shape(狀態)屬性,下面是對應的理解 ...
broadcast 是 numpy 中 array 的一個重要操作。 首先,broadcast 只適用於加減。 然后,broadcast 執行的時候,如果兩個 array 的 shape 不一樣,會先給“短”的那一個,增加高維度“擴展”(broadcasting),比如,一個 ...
今天在復習PCA的過程中,發現自己對numpy多維數組的“軸”理解的不是很好,借此機會來總結一下。 網上有很多博客都寫的是二維數組,axis=0表示第一維度,即行。axis=1表示第二維度,列。但是設計到多維就有點不知所錯。 舉個網上存在的例子幫助理解: >> data2 ...